best /best/ I. adj. (good, well的最高级最好的:This is the best book I have ever read.这是我所读过的最好的书。Second thoughts are best.[谚]三思而后行。‖II.adv.(well的最高级)最好地: He works best who is best trained. 受过最好训练的人,能做最好的工作。‖III. n. 用于习语at best 充其量,至多:At best we can do only half as much as last year. 我们充其量也只能干到去年的一半。We can’t arrive before Friday at best. 再快,周五前也到不了。do/try one’s best 尽力: I don’t think I can finish it within this week, but I’ll try my best. 我看这星期之内完成不了,但我要尽我最大的努力。 make the best of 尽量利用:If you cannot have the best, make the best of what you have. [谚]如果没有更好的,就充分利用现有的。We must learn to make the best of a bad job. 我们要学着在不利的情况下尽量少受损失。 get the best of 战胜:After a long struggle, we got the best of them. 拼了好长时间,我们终于战胜了他们。
